Разработка, производство и продажа радиоэлектронной аппаратуры
|
Карта сайта
|
Пишите нам
|
В избранное
Требуется программист в Зеленограде
- обработка данных с датчиков; ColdFire; 40 тыс.
e-mail:
jobsmp@pochta.ru
Телесистемы
|
Электроника
|
Конференция «Микроконтроллеры и их применение»
Подскажите, как в AVRStudio видеть значения переменных в окне Watch если там постоянно висит надпись Not in scope?
Отправлено
MikhailSh
(192.168.100.78,83.242.253.134)
15 июля 2010, г. 15:17
Составить ответ
|
Вернуться на конференцию
Ответы
Может оптимизатор её выкинуть. Если на С пишешь, выключи оптимизатор и посмотри на результат.
-
Michael_75
(15.07.2010, 15:49:2
80.249.236.234
,
пустое
)
Оптимизатор выключен -О0
-
MikhailSh
(15.07.2010, 16:33:47
192.168.100.78,83.242.253.134
,
пустое
)
Дизассемблером посмотри что процессор делает с переменной.
-
Michael_75
(15.07.2010, 17:09:8
80.249.236.234
,
пустое
)
Может быть настройки какие сделать надо?
-
MikhailSh
(15.07.2010, 19:53:0
109.226.118.241
,
пустое
)
А в Name что написано? там имя переменной должно быть, или хоть R15 или например MCUCR
-
maik-vs
(15.07.2010, 15:21:16
178.34.20.167
,
пустое
)
Там имя глобальной переменной. Вставляю с помощью Add Watch.
-
MikhailSh
(15.07.2010, 15:28:39
192.168.100.78,83.242.253.134
,
пустое
)
Хорошо, а локальные переменные кажет?
-
maik-vs
(15.07.2010, 15:40:32
178.34.20.167
,
пустое
)
Локальные показывает. Для отладки нужно будет везде в проге вставлять копирование в локальную преже чем посмотреть?
-
MikhailSh
(15.07.2010, 15:48:17
192.168.100.78,83.242.253.134
,
пустое
)
Да нормально показывает глобальные переменные, никогда проблем не было.
-
Michael_75
(15.07.2010, 16:02:35
80.249.236.234
,
пустое
)
И структуры тоже?
-
MikhailSh
(15.07.2010, 16:35:21
192.168.100.78,83.242.253.134
,
пустое
)
И структуры тоже. Пишем в IARe, отлаживаем в нём-же или в AVR студио. Везде корректно всё.
-
Michael_75
(15.07.2010, 16:41:14
80.249.236.234
,
пустое
)
да и ручками написать можно.
-
maik-vs
(15.07.2010, 15:39:13
178.34.20.167
,
пустое
)
Отправка ответа
Имя*:
Пароль:
E-mail:
Тема*:
Сообщение:
Ссылка на URL:
URL изображения:
если вы незарегистрированный на форуме пользователь, то
для успешного добавления сообщения заполните поле, как указано ниже:
введите число 63:
Перейти к списку ответов
|
Конференция
|
Раздел "Электроника"
|
Главная страница
|
Карта сайта
Web
telesys.ru